If the angles of a triangle are in the ratio of 2:3:4,
determine the three angles​

Answer: let the angles of the triangle be x

then 2x + 3x + 4x

By angle sum property of triangle,

2x + 3x + 4x = 180°

9x = 180°

x = 180/9

∴ x = 20

All the angles are : 2x = 2 × 20 = 40°

3x = 3 × 20 = 60°

4x = 4 × 20 = 80°

∴ 40°, 60° and 80° are the angles of the triangle.
